2000 Egyptian League Cup 2000 كأس الدوري المصري Dates 4 Feb 2000 – 26 May 2000 Teams 11 Champions El-Qanah (1st title) Runners-up Dina
International football competition
2000 Egyptian League Cup , it was the first ever edition, participation first division teams only on voluntary basis.
Clubs play without international players (matches played during African Nations' Cup and Olympic qualifiers ).
Ahly, Mansoura and El Ittihad Alexandria declined to participate.[1]
